 A watchtower was manly a type of fortification found on most castles and as the word suggests a place to watch from, in other words it was an observation place, and was the highest point of a castle,  also known as “The keep” the basement of the keep served as a prison hence the name.

 It was originally called a donjon a French word and in England became known as dungeon the word developed as slang for “The keep”

 During a battle the more important members of the castle could retreat to it as a last resort. keeps also sometimes kept prisoners, one of the most famous towers in the world can be found in London, the tower of London also known as “The bloody tower, is well known for the many political prisoners it held including

Anne Boleyn queen of England

Catherine Howard, Queen of England

King Henry VI

The two princes Edward V and his brother Richard, Duke of York

Sir Thomas More

Thomas Cromwell

Guy Fawkes

Sir Walter Raleigh

Rudolf Hess

And in the 50s for just one night, the Kray Twins

It is considered so secure that the crown Jewels are kept there.

And finally a little trivia for you, ravens are residence at the tower, and a superstition claims that if the ravens ever leave, then the Kingdom of Great Britain will fall.
